Benjamin Moore Color of the Year 2023

Benjamin Moore’s Color of the Year for 2023 is Raspberry Blush, described as “a vivacious shade of coral tinged with pink.” 

This optimistic hue is part of Benjamin Moore’s Color Trends 2023, an entire color palette “built to envelop you in vivacious color.” 

Home color trends 2023
Benjamin Moore Raspberry Blush (2008-30)

Besides the 2023 Color of the Year, Raspberry Blush, the Benjamin Moore 2023 Color Palette includes Conch Shell (a gentle dusty pink), Cinnamon (a rich brown with orange undertones), Wenge (a deep chocolate with hints of violet), Savannah Green (a balanced shade of ochre), New Age (an ethereal light purple with a hint of gray), Starry Night Blue (a deep navy color akin to indigo), and North Sea Green (a relaxing blend of blue-green).

Any of the shades in the 2023 Color Trends palette would pair beautifully with neutral hues.  Benjamin Moore recommends Etiquette (AF-50), White Heron (OC-57), Gray Owl (OC-52), and Onyx (2133-10) as neutrals with warm, cool, and neutral undertones– perfectly suited for using as a trim or accent color with Raspberry Blush or any of the other colors in the palette.

Behr’s Color of the Year for 2023 is Blank Canvas (DC-003) a warm, cozy shade of white.  I happen to love that Behr chose white as their color of the year, because it’s a great option for any room in the home.

This shade of white is similar to Benjamin Moore White Dove (which we’ve used throughout our home) and would work well with just about any other color, including other warm neutral beiges and tans.

Sherwin Williams Color of the Year 2023

The Sherwin Williams 2023 Color of the Year is a warm, earthy tone called Redend Point (SW-9081).

Valspar Colors of the Year

Rather than just one shade, Valspar announced a collection of Colors of the Year for 2023, radiating joy, light, optimism, and warmth.  

Home color trends 2023
Valspar Everglade Deck

The Valspar 2023 Colors of the Year are livable shades that would work well in just about any space in the home. 

The 2023 color palette includes Ivory Brown, Cozy White, Gentle Violet, Blue Arrow, Flora, Desert Carnation, Green Trellis, Rising Tide, Holmes Cream, Southern Road, Villa Grey, and Everglade Deck.
